Why would a team need to connect two CRM systems?
Common reasons include a merger or acquisition where each side kept its own CRM, or separate teams (direct sales vs. partner-led) standardized on different tools that still need shared contact and deal data.
Does this cause duplicate contact records?
No — the Agent can match on email or a shared identifier to update an existing contact in the other system instead of creating a duplicate.
